This five-bedroom Victorian terraced house is set over five floors. It boasts a tremendously proportioned kitchen and family room on the lower level, an eye-catching double reception room featuring an original fireplace, a bay window to the front, a patio door leading to a south-facing terrace and high ceilings accompanied by a mixture of characterful cornices, replica Victorian-style moulding and a reclaimed ceiling rose. Wooden flooring adorns the ground floor, stairs and landings, and other characterful features one would expect with a house from this period.
The main family bathroom has a roll-top bathtub, walk-in shower, pedestal basin, and toilet and is overlooked by attractive exposed brickwork to one side, glamorous tiles and a sash cord window overlooking the rear.
There are two equally substantial double bedrooms, a further double, single bedroom and a loft converted bedroom with ensuite shower room on the very top level.
The south-facing garden leads from the kitchen area through bi-fold doors, and there is a further reception room to the front of the house, which has separate access from a second front door.
Kelvin Road runs directly from Highbury Barn and is a no-through turn. The current owners are part of a very friendly neighbourhood where they have built up several close relationships over the last 12 years.
